The Japan sway bar bush market is characterized by a steady demand for high-quality automotive suspension components. The market is driven by the country`s advanced automotive industry, strict quality standards, and a strong emphasis on vehicle safety and performance. Japanese consumers prioritize durable and reliable sway bar bushes to ensure smooth handling and stability while driving. Key players in the market focus on innovation, technological advancements, and environmental sustainability to meet the evolving needs of customers. The market is also influenced by factors such as government regulations, economic conditions, and competition from international manufacturers. Overall, the Japan sway bar bush market is poised for growth as automakers and consumers continue to prioritize safety, comfort, and performance in vehicles.
The Japan Sway Bar Bush market is experiencing growth due to the increasing demand for high-performance vehicles and the rising emphasis on vehicle safety and stability. Consumers are seeking sway bar bushes that offer improved handling, reduced body roll, and enhanced driving experience. There is a growing preference for polyurethane sway bar bushes over rubber ones, as polyurethane offers better durability and performance. Manufacturers are also focusing on developing innovative materials and designs to cater to the evolving needs of customers. Additionally, the market is witnessing a shift towards online sales channels, providing consumers with easy access to a wide range of products and competitive pricing. Overall, the Japan Sway Bar Bush market is expected to continue expanding as automotive technology advances and consumer preferences evolve.

The government policies related to the Japan Sway Bar Bush Market primarily focus on regulations aimed at ensuring the safety and quality standards of automotive parts, including sway bar bushes. The Ministry of Land, Infrastructure, Transport and Tourism (MLIT) in Japan plays a crucial role in establishing and enforcing these regulations to prevent the sale of counterfeit or substandard products that could compromise road safety. Additionally, there are specific guidelines in place for manufacturers and suppliers to adhere to in terms of production practices and materials used in sway bar bushes to maintain high industry standards. Overall, the government`s policies aim to safeguard consumers and uphold the reputation of the Japanese automotive parts industry.
